About the Book
Join Dragon C, Charlie, and Ying Ying on a flavourful exploration of Chinese food! From ancient meals, and seasonal farming to the eight main styles of Chinese cuisine, children will savour every bite, uncovering the history of Chinese food. They will also learn about table manners in this fun-filled cultural adventure.

Illustrator
Sheung Wong
Sheung Wong is a talented illustrator from Hong Kong. Despite being born deaf, her passion for drawing has been with her since childhood. Graduating with a master’s degree in Printmaking from the Guangzhou Academy of Fine Arts, Sheung combines printmaking, and pencil and chalk textures with digital techniques. She has been creating illustrations for various companies and publishers since 2014.
